The cell is full of foam, and mounted. Stupid Amazon sent the two hard line fittings that go on the return port of the pump in two separate shipments.One each in a padded envelope. I have one, but the other fitting is in LaLa land.
The Chevy radiator is mounted, as is the CATSUCKER 3 cooling fan.
The “ much larger than before” AC condenser is mounted, and the lines are attached. That puts the AC system fully in the “Done” box.
The upper and lower radiator hoses are made out of steel. They are done. Waiting on paint to dry. Each end of the steel “ hose” has a section of silicone hose clamped on it so it can be installed. All that is left after the paint dries is to get a new Tstat, and put them on.
